Ferrari team tweak 'not the solution' - Schumacher

Jul.27 Ralf Schumacher doubts Ferrari's organisational shakeup will fix the struggling Italian team's problems. Last week, following the Maranello outfit's horror start to 2020, it was announced that a new Performance Development department had been created. "It sounds to me like they are trying to demonstrate to the outside world that something is changing," Schumacher, whose brother Michael won five titles for Ferrari, told Sky Deutschland. "I am not entirely sure that this is the solution." Indeed, the former Williams and Toyota driver predicts that it will take a long time for Ferrari to get its performance levels back on track.
